What sizes do window scarves come in?
Window Scarf Size Chart
| Width | Number of 6 yard scarves needed |
|---|---|
| Up to 36 inches | 1 |
| 42 inches to 72 inches | 2 |
| 78 inches to 108 inches | 3 |
How do you hang a scarf on a bay window?
Start by draping one end over the rod from behind; wrap the scarf valance around the rod three or four times, with the ends hanging down on the outside of the two side windows. For each wrap, pull the material down for a swag look; the swags hang alternately over and under the rod.

What are window scarves made of?
Organza and chiffon are the most popular sheers for window scarves and suit nearly any style room or window. Lightweight gauze is casual and beachy, evoking the feel of a seaside cottage.
